The Math Behind Video Poker: Understanding RTP and Variance
The Return to Player (RTP) percentage is a critical metric in determining the profitability of a video poker machine. The RTP indicates how much of the wagered money a game will return to players over time. For instance, a machine with a RTP of 98% suggests that over a long period, players can expect to receive back $98 for every $100 wagered.
Variance, or volatility, is another essential factor. High variance games may offer larger payouts but come with less frequent wins, while low variance games provide smaller, more consistent payouts. Players should choose a game that aligns with their risk tolerance and bankroll strategy.
Optimal Strategies for Maximizing Payouts
- Know the Game Variants: Different video poker variants have unique strategies. For example, Jacks or Better requires different approaches compared to Deuces Wild.
- Utilize Strategy Charts: Employing a strategy chart specific to your chosen variant can increase your odds significantly. These charts provide guidance on the optimal decisions to make based on your hand.
- Practice with Free Versions: Many online casinos offer free versions of video poker, allowing players to practice without risk. This practice can help in mastering strategies before wagering real money.
Bankroll Management: Protecting Your Funds
Effective bankroll management is crucial for sustaining long-term gameplay. Here are some practical tips:
- Set a Budget: Determine how much you are willing to lose in a session and stick to that limit.
- Use a Unit Size: Divide your bankroll into units. For instance, if your bankroll is $500 and you play $1 per hand, you have 500 units to play.
- Adjust Wagering Based on Bankroll: If you experience losses, consider lowering your bet size to prolong your playtime.
Common Mistakes to Avoid
- Ignoring Strategy Charts: Failure to implement optimal strategies can lead to unnecessary losses.
- Chasing Losses: Increasing your bets after a losing streak can quickly deplete your bankroll.
- Neglecting Game Research: Not understanding the specific rules and payout structures of different video poker games can lead to poor decision-making.
Hidden Risks: What Every Player Should Know
While video poker can be lucrative, players must be aware of the hidden risks:
- Misunderstanding Pay Tables: Each machine has a unique pay table that affects the RTP. Players should always check this before playing.
- Inconsistent Game Quality: Not all video poker machines are created equal. Look for machines with a solid reputation and favorable RTP.
- Emotional Play: Letting emotions dictate your betting strategy can lead to impulsive decisions that jeopardize your bankroll.
Table: Comparing Popular Video Poker Variants
| Game Variant | RTP (%) | Variance | Strategy Complexity |
|---|---|---|---|
| Jacks or Better | 99.54% | Medium | Low |
| Deuces Wild | 100.76% | High | High |
| Double Bonus | 100.17% | High | Medium |
